In Faith and In Doubt: How Religious Believers and Nonbelievers Can Create Strong Marriages and Loving Families Dale Mcgowan
In Faith and In Doubt: How Religious Believers and Nonbelievers Can Create Strong Marriages and Loving Families
Dale Mcgowan
Interfaith marriages fail more often than same-faith partnerships. So what are the chances of survival for the ultimate mixed marriage - one between religious and nonreligious partners? This book helps partners navigate the complexities of their situation while celebrating the richness it affords their relationship, and those around them.
